John Williams - Star Wars: Episode III - Revenge of the Sith (Original Soundtrack) (Red 2LP Vinyl)
Composed by John Williams for George Lucas’s 2005 film "Star Wars: Episode III – Revenge of the Sith," this soundtrack captures the tragic fall of Anakin Skywalker—his fear of losing Padmé, his desire for recognition, and his growing arrogance lead him down the dark path to become Darth Vader, an agent of fear across the galaxy. Yet, even within the darkness, traces of light remain. Alongside the series’ iconic themes, Williams introduces powerful new compositions such as "Battle of the Heroes" and "Anakin vs. Obi-Wan." The album concludes by returning to the beginning of the saga with "A New Hope and End Credits."
Tracklisting:
- Star Wars Main Title - Revenge of the Sith
- Anakin's Dream
- Battle of the Heroes
- Anakin's Betrayal
- General Grievous
- Palpatine's Teachings
- Grievous and the Droids
- Padme's Ruminations
- Anakin vs. Obi-Wan
- Anakin's Dark Deeds
- Enter Lord Vader
- Hellfire The Immolation Scene
- Grievous Speaks to Lord Sidious
- The Birth of the Twins and Padme's Destiny
- A New Hope and End Credits
